As nouns the difference between marmot and capybara

is that marmot is any of several large ground-dwelling rodents of the genera Marmota and genus: Cynomys in the squirrel family while capybara is a semi-aquatic South American rodent, species: Hydrochoerus hydrochaeris, the largest living rodent.

  • * 1914 , , Through the Brazilian Wilderness , 2004, page 53,
  • It was tenanted by the small caymans and by capybaras - the largest known rodent, a huge aquatic guinea-pig, the size of a small sheep.
  • * 2009 , The Illustrated Atlas of Wildlife , page 106,
  • The largest of all the 1,729 rodent species, the semi-aquatic capybara' is extremely agile in the water, using its partly webbed toes like tiny paddles. Troops containing up to 20 animals live along riverbanks where young ' capybaras are sometimes preyed on by caimans.
